Pishgoyacu
Pishgoyacu is a hamlet in San Buenaventura District, Marañón, Marañón Province, Huánuco Department. Pishgoyacu is situated nearby to the hamlet Ganto Hirca, as well as near Huasin.| Tap on a place to explore it |
